Indonesia's entertainment scene has undergone a seismic shift, transforming from traditional media dominance to a vibrant, digital-first landscape. With over 200 million internet users, the country has become a massive hub for content creation, streaming, and viral trends. Indonesian entertainment is no longer just local; it is rapidly gaining international attention, driven by engaging, relatable, and often hilarious digital content. Indonesian entertainment has also been shaped by the rise of talent shows and competitions. Indonesian Idol, a singing competition that was first broadcast in 2004, has become a launching pad for many successful Indonesian musicians. The show has produced numerous winners who have gone on to achieve significant success in the Indonesian music industry.

The undisputed king for long-form content, talk shows, and official music videos. Digital podcast setups (pioneered by figures like Deddy Corbuzier) have largely replaced traditional TV talk shows as the primary medium for political, social, and entertainment discourse.
Furthermore, the fight for attention is brutal. To keep the algorithm happy, creators churn out "content sludge"—daily, repetitive videos that burn out stars quickly. Mental health is becoming a crisis among Indonesia’s young digital celebrities.
